BLOCLEats

Babouch

29 PORTLAND PLACE
LONDON
W1B1QB

Food rating: 5/5 stars
Updated: 8. July 2020

map for Babouch

Restaurant nearby

  1. Association Of Anaesthetists, W1B1PY
  2. Energy Institute, W1G7AR
  3. Jackolope, W1G7EQ
  4. Lexington@Nursing Midwifery Council, W1B1PZ
  5. Liu Xiaomian, W1G7EQ
  6. 0.1 miles Baxter Storey Limited, W1B1DJ
  7. 0.1 miles Healthcare By Ch&Co Catering Ltd, W1B1LU
  8. 0.1 miles Mycafe - The Harley Building, W1W6XB
  9. 0.1 miles Stag'S Head Public House, W1W6XW
  10. 0.1 miles The Ground Floor Cafe, W1W6XB
  11. 0.1 miles Caffe Nero, W1A1AA